Teaser Talk: Shamshera, Bollywood Tries It Again

Though Bollywood successfully made period films like Lagaan, Jodhaa Akbar earlier, somehow they are unable to withstand the “Baahubali” madness that took them by a storm, a couple of years ago. In that process, the likes of Yash Raj Films tried their hand at many large scale visual effects fantasies. However, most of them ended up like Thugs of Hindostan only.

Right now, YRF is getting ready to test their luck yet again with the film “Shamshera” featuring Ranbir Kapoor in the lead. The film deals with the story of a tribe in a period backdrop and how a bandit rises to the rank of a legend to save them. With the teaser, director Karan Malhotra who has made films like Agneepath and Brothers has proved that he has come up with an intense drama with terrific visual effects.

While the trailer of the movie will be unveiled in a couple of days, many are seeing this project as Bollywood’s another try at Baahubali and KGF level work, and everyone is hoping that it works, at least due to the Ranbir Kapoor factor. So far, the visuals are terrific but what needs to work out on the screen is the story arc and the screenplay.
